1. Creamy Chicken & Broccoli Cheddar Bake
This wholesome casserole combines tender chicken pieces, crisp broccoli florets, and a luscious cheddar sauce, all baked until bubbly and golden. It’s a hearty option that delivers on both flavour and protein, making it an excellent choice for a nutritious dinner.
- Chicken breast
- Broccoli
- Cheddar cheese
- Greek yoghurt or cream cheese
- Chicken stock
Quick tip: To ensure your chicken stays moist, consider poaching or baking it whole before dicing and adding to the casserole.
2. Beef & Lentil Shepherd’s Pie
A robust take on a British classic, this shepherd’s pie features a rich minced beef and lentil base, topped with fluffy mashed potatoes. The lentils boost the fibre and protein content, making for a truly substantial and satisfying dish with deep, savoury notes.
- Minced beef
- Brown or green lentils
- Potatoes
- Carrots & peas
- Beef stock
Quick tip: For extra flavour, caramelise your onions well before adding the minced beef and lentils to build a strong foundation.

5. Turkey & Courgette Lasagne
This lighter, yet equally satisfying, lasagne layers lean minced turkey with thinly sliced courgettes (instead of some pasta sheets), a rich tomato sauce, and creamy ricotta. It’s a fantastic way to enjoy a beloved Italian dish while boosting your protein intake and reducing carbs, making it a great option for healthy eating.
- Minced turkey
- Courgettes
- Ricotta cheese
- Lasagne sheets
- Passata & herbs
Quick tip: Squeeze excess water from the grated courgettes to prevent your lasagne from becoming watery.

8. Breakfast Sausage & Egg Strata
Who says casseroles are just for dinner? This savoury strata combines lean breakfast sausages, eggs, cheese, and wholemeal bread into a custardy, baked dish that’s fantastic any time of day. It’s an excellent way to get a protein boost, whether for breakfast, brunch, or a light evening meal.
- Lean breakfast sausages
- Eggs
- Wholemeal bread
- Milk & cheese
- Peppers & onions
Quick tip: For the best texture, assemble the strata the night before and let it soak in the fridge; this allows the bread to fully absorb the egg mixture.
